I agree with Glenn, that most probably you are trying to send keys to
external application, for which you can use FindWindow().
But why are you NOT using SendKeys.Send() ?
Example:
private void Form1_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
SendKeys.Send("% "); // this will send ALT+SPACE to
current application to open the Window Menu
}
